Question: An attacker at the base of a castle wall 3.60 m high throws a rock straight up with speed 4.50 m/s from a height of 1.40 m above the ground.

Part A: Will the rock reach the top of the wall?

Part B: If so, what is its speed at the top? If not, what initial speed must it have to reach the top?

Part C: Find the change in speed of a rock thrown straight down from the top of the wall at an initial speed of 4.50 m/s and moving between the same two points.

Part D: Does the change in speed of the downward-moving rock agree with the magnitude of the speed change of the rock moving upward between the same elevations? Explain physically why it does or does not agree.
